Unpack the mod .7z file. You’ll typically find a folder like: Japanese_Voice\dat\ → inside are .fpk and .dat files (e.g., sound_eng.fpk , stream_eng.fpk ).

Some mods keep Japanese files with _jpn suffixes – if so, you may need to rename them to the English filenames (e.g., sound_jpn.fpk → sound_eng.fpk ). metal gear rising revengeance japanese voice mod

A voice mod, short for voice modification or modding, refers to the alteration of a game's audio files to replace the original voice acting with new recordings or, in this case, the Japanese voice track. This can be achieved through various technical means, including patching the game's audio files or installing a mod that swaps out the voice acting. The Metal Gear Rising: Revengeance Japanese Voice Mod specifically replaces the English voice acting with the authentic Japanese voice acting, providing a more immersive experience for players.
